Preallocate the xfrm buffer's storage in the plane's atomic_check
function if a format conversion will be necessary. Allows the update
to fail if no memory is available. Avoids the same allocation within
atomic_update, which may not fail.

Also inline drm_plane_helper_atomic_check() into the driver and thus
return early for invisible planes. Avoids memory allocation entirely
in this case.
